If you would like to stay with him you may write the entire situation as mentioned in your question in a letter and mail it to him via registered post to settle the misunderstanding within certain time period from the receipt of your letter, failing which you have following legal recourse:

1. to file restitution of conjugal rights in family court. The court would order him to accept you and would help you to settle the matter; if possible amicably;

2. Domestic Violence Act;

3. Worst case scenario, if there is mental harassment; as a last resort, without any practical possibility of reconciliation you may lodge 498A with the nearest police station. However, please ensure that facts are presented and there seems to be deliberate harassment and cruelty caused to you.
